We hired Tayyibaat to cater for my son's wedding and it was a home run. I don't recall being at a wedding feeding 150+ people where people go out of their way to comment how good the food was. That was our experience. I don't think you can get this level of quality and flavor for a large event without adding an extra 5k to the price tag. Literally everything they served was a hit from the meat, to the sauces, to even the classic Afghan salad with diced up onions, tomatoes, and cucumbers. Be sure to get the eggplant as well.

Come for the food and not the ambiance. Great food and good service. Dining area is small, ~6x tables in the entrance to the butcher shop. Simple menu. Beef, chicken or lamb prepared cubed or ground. My goto is the lamb chili kabobs served with rice and cucumber salad. My wife really liked their burger and fries. They also have roast chicken which is a good take home option.
